[QUOTE="Darryl Cassel, post: 21082, member: 34"] Guy Run the ballistics for the 300 Sierra MK at .800 BC. It will work out much closer to your drop charts at the speed you are running the bullet. We are driving the 300 gr much faster from our 37 1/2" to 40" barrels and found that the drop charts were off when using the lower BC. Oehler reports the 300 gr 338 MK at .800 BC. A 300 gr will most certanly hit harder then the 30 cal coming from a 300 Win mag. You have a great place to reach the new 338 out.
